Program Overview & Curriculum

Bachelor of Business Administration (BBA) in Human Resources Management
Major: Human Resources Management
Minor: Student doing major in Human Resources Management may choose his/her minor any one from the following disciplines:
  • Accounting
  • Finance
  • General Management
  • Management Information System (MIS)
  • International Business
  • Marketing
  • Supply Chain Management
Program Overview & Curriculum

Requirements for the Bachelor of Business Administration in Human Resources Management

Credit Distribution:

Sl. NoCategory of CoursesDistribution of Credits
1General Education/Foundation Courses36 Credits
2Core Courses57 Credits
3Major Courses23 Credits
4Minor Courses15 Credits
5LFE (Live-in-Field Experience)3 Credits
6Internship/Research Project6 Credits
 Total requirement for the degree140 credits

Graduate Attributes:

  • Knowledgeable in contemporary issues of the business and management;
  • Creative, innovative, and conscientious;
  • Having business intelligence, leadership, professionalism, and problem-solving skills;
  • Having negotiation, communication, persuasiveness, critical thinking, and decision-making ability;
  • Tendency to develop teamwork ability, intercultural competency, inquisitiveness, self-awareness, and a lifelong learning habit.
     
Duration of the program: 4 years;
